Output e808abe3921cb67fc2fc4447886e5af34f4feb4e0dbd1071bc354d97d4fec0aa:1

value
15912159
script pubkey
OP_0 OP_PUSHBYTES_32 3f49381d8568660a8164ce9b5bb5b4d4fc252fe6328678c85e70099e2ae8afb4
address
bc1q8ayns8v9dpnq4qtye6d4hdd56n7z2tlxx2r83jz7wqyeu2hg476q6qf6j8
transaction
e808abe3921cb67fc2fc4447886e5af34f4feb4e0dbd1071bc354d97d4fec0aa
confirmations
11599
spent
true